"I love my '94 Geo Metro XFi. I may finally be retiring it this year because the frame is now rusted out - can't prevent rust. But it's been an extremely reliable car. I have had no major issues with it until recently - all rust related. The gas mileage averages 40mpg. It has traveled across the country and back, been in all weather conditions. The only issue was traversing the Rockies, but it made it. I wish they still made this car. Since it was originally a Suzuki Swift, I'm looking towards Suzuki as a replacement. If you want luxury or power, this isn't the car for you. But if you want a spartan gas sipping economy car, this is it. It turns on a dime, parks anywhere, and has surprisingly large cargo space for its size, with the design of the hatch."

"I bought my 94 XFI used in 1998 from a couple that used it as a tow car behind their Rv. Ive used it as a dedicated commuter car between San Diego and Chicago since. Averages 59 MPG, 54 MPG with AC in the desserts. No major problems keeps up with my Tercel in reliability and beats a Boeing 737 for cross country travel cost. Its not built for collision I wanted to add a roll cage, but likely safer than a motorcycle or plane. The 1.0L is the only engine Ive run cross country that used no oil. The XFI is the University of California pulse and glide champ averaging 119 MPG. Havent had a chance to try it, but heard they can get up to 138 MPG. I have mine equipped with high power VHF/UHF, GPS, Echolink, and wireless internet for cross country driving. Really a joy to own I can scoot across the country at will covering my 2150 mile commute for around 34 gallons, it handles the mountains and high speed desert driving with ease never a sign of over heating even with AC on through the Mojave by Las Vegas."
